    McAfee reports blocked buffer overflow

    Yesterday, when I selected AVI (DivX) without opening it; McAfee reports that it has blocked "a buffer overflow"

    I spent AdAware and McAfee, they do nothing!

    What is it?

    Re: McAfee reports blocked buffer overflow

    In the console, McAfee (VirusScan Console), there is an item called "buffer overflow protection". You will get it by right clicking on McAfee and select properties. Configure this protection (enable / disable the protection, define exclusions, choose the level of protection) and also view the reports for errors such protection.
